When you can spend $12,000 or more for a car, you could get a well loaded Mazda 6, Opel Astra or a Hyundai Accent. You might likewise find a Yaris for that much in the process. It is possible to find some BMWs, but only older models that will probably consume quite a substantial amount of gas.
Should your spending plan easily exceeds $13,000, you can probably consider getting a new car instead of a used one. A good car is the Mitsubishi Colt even though it is a bit noisy inside. Furthermore, you will not get very much money if you think about selling it later.
Suzuki Swift is another terrific car, but it can be small. You can find enough room for the driver but for the remainder of the car, it’s a bit cramped. That model with the 1.25 engine saves on gasoline but it is not a particularly good drive, which will not be worth it for the price.
The Hyundai Accent 1.5 is a vehicle that offers decent optional features and good warranty. The service on this particular car is considered very good and their warranty covers five years or 100,000 kilometers.
Another good car brand is Skoda and has the new Fabia with 68 HP engine. Having said that, the service is not so great, and you could have problems repairing it at your local garage.
A brand new Renault Clio with an engine of 1.5 and 65 horse power has enough room for bigger persons. It doesn’t spend much gas at 5.4 liters per 100 km inside the city and an even more impressive 3.8 liters on the road.
